Transaction 7529e82fe28a82ab300cb4019702dbefde2eb6ce174c988add644838908ee9b7
1 Input
1 Output
-
7529e82fe28a82ab300cb4019702dbefde2eb6ce174c988add644838908ee9b7:0
- value
- 5692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b63ee8776cf9d2a8bb2fd78cdf4f2e0404d8476 OP_EQUAL
- address
- 3FreNf65VBhriFJdD4BU7KGrbQeSaq1VBH